prop adapter?
So I bought a hydromotive prop the other day. Got it for a good price and was rather eager to try it out. The only problem is that I forgot to ask the shaft size! Doh! It's a 1.25" Xr shaft and I have the old 1" prop shaft. This isn't a problem with the flo-torque hubs because you can just change it out. But no! Hydromotive welds their hubs in! I know that we can cut the hub out and replace it, but now I own the prop and I still don't know if it'll work. Is anybody capable of making a adapter that could be used?
